Domino's Pizza Chain
The Domino's pizza chain is renowned worldwide not only for their delicious pies but also for their unique approach to advertising. They gained widespread fame for the innovative concept of baking pizzas on wheels – the pizza was prepared on the go as the delivery vehicle made its way to the customer. This ensured that the client received a hot, freshly-made pizza, sparking public interest. Taking it a step further, the company introduced the pizza delivery robot – DRU.

Robotic Pizza Delivery
Autonomous robots will now be delivering pizzas in Queensland, Australia. While currently an experiment, if proven economically viable, this service may expand to other cities. Unlike quadcopters or drones, these robots resemble small vehicles that navigate sidewalks rather than roads.

As of now, these robots are more suited for small towns or residential areas rather than bustling metropolises due to heavy traffic and security concerns.


While it is premature to predict the future viability of this project, the company has certainly captured public attention. All that remains is to await the outcomes of this groundbreaking experiment.
